CBI stands for community-based instruction. CBI is a data-driven, guided outing that occurs in a natural setting where the student can work toward an IEP goal. CBI most often happens in placements where the student is in a lifeskills program. However, if your child is not ready to graduate at 18 and still needs some assistance, I have seen a ...State your objectives in quantifiable terms. State your objectives in terms of outcomes, not process. Objectives should specify the result of an activity. Objectives should identify the target audience or community being served. Objectives need to be realistic and capable of being accomplished within the grant period.Aug 3, 2023 · Goal. Improve decision making skills by developing innovative ways to measure alternatives.
